slot demo

A slot demo is a virtual version of a casino game that allows players to practice before making real money wagers. It can be found on many online casinos and is a great way to get familiar with the rules, odds, bonuses, and payout schedule before investing cash. It also helps to practice winning strategies before putting them into play for money.

While some players may choose to avoid slot demos, seasoned players know the value of this practice mode. It is not only a convenient way to try out new games, but it can also help players determine whether a particular developer’s slots are right for them. In addition, a slot demo can help players understand the different types of payouts and bonus features offered by various developers.

Most reputable online casinos will provide their customers with a slot demo, which is designed to be a close representation of the full version you’ll find in their live casinos. These demos are usually free to play and can be accessed on desktop computers, laptops, and mobile devices. They are also available in many languages, and most will allow you to win virtual money for a limited time. However, it is important to note that the virtual money cannot be withdrawn.

The slot demo is a valuable tool for players, especially those who are new to online gambling. It gives them the chance to test out a slot machine before they commit any money. Moreover, it lets them see how the game plays and whether they are comfortable with it. In addition, the slot demo can help them understand how to trigger bonus rounds and other game features.
